Sam Bankman-Fried’s New Motion for New Trial in Manhattan Court
Former FTX CEO Sam Bankman-Fried has filed a new motion for a new trial in Manhattan federal court to overturn his 25-year prison sentence for fraud charges. In the petition filed on February 5 by his mother, retired Stanford law professor Barbara Fried, it is argued that statements from former FTX executives Daniel Chapsky and Ryan Salame, who were not available during the trial, could undermine the government’s narrative regarding FTX’s financial situation before its November 2022 collapse. Bankman-Fried also requested review by a different judge, claiming that Judge Lewis Kaplan acted with bias.
The Importance of Daniel Chapsky and Ryan Salame’s Statements
The petition is a separate appeal to Bankman-Fried’s 2023 conviction on seven counts, and new trial requests are rarely granted. The testimonies of Chapsky and Salame could provide evidence in favor of the defense by reinterpreting FTX’s financial structure. Although Ryan Salame, as a former senior FTX executive, has pleaded guilty to the charges, his new statements could alter the causes of the collapse. This move is part of SBF’s long-term legal battle.

Ongoing Payments to Creditors from FTX Bankruptcy Estate
On the other hand, the FTX bankruptcy estate has returned billions of dollars to creditors in 2025 through remaining assets managed by court officials, and additional payments continue. These developments show that the FTX legacy is partially compensated.
